Stock market update: Stocks that hit 52-week lows on NSE in today's trade

Bharti Airtel, Apollo Hospital, Hindalco, Tata Steel and Bajaj Finserv were among the top losers on NSE in today's trade.

Nagaraj Shetti, Technical Research Analyst at HDFC Securities, believes Monday's pattern could be considered as a High Wave, which reflects high volatility in the market at swing highs.
NEW DELHI: Godha Cabcon & Insul, Sintex Inds., C.E. Info Systems Ltd., Goenka Diamond and Baheti Recycling Industries Ltd. and others were among the stocks that touched their 52-week lows in today's trade.

Domestic benchmark index NSE Nifty ended 9.8 points down at 18122.5, while the BSE Sensex closed 17.15 points down at 60910.28.

On the other hand, Dollex Agrotech Ltd., Aries Agro, Network People Services Technologies Ltd., Arvind SmartSpaces and FACT stocks hit their fresh 52-week highs today.


In the Nifty 50 index, Titan Company, M&M, Power Grid, Maruti Suzuki and UPL were among the top gainers on the NSE in the today's trade.

Meanwhile, Bharti Airtel, Apollo Hospital, Hindalco, Tata Steel and Bajaj Finserv were among the top losers of the day.
